海浪法线贴图是现代游戏和电影中模拟真实海洋景观的重要技术之一。通过使用这种贴图,开发者能够创造出令人叹为观止的海浪效果,为玩家和观众带来沉浸式的体验。本文将深入探讨海浪法线贴图的工作原理、制作方法以及在实际应用中的技巧。
一、海浪法线贴图概述
1.1 什么是海浪法线贴图?
海浪法线贴图(Normal Map)是一种用于模拟表面细节的纹理贴图。它通过模拟表面的凹凸变化,给二维图像增加三维效果。在海浪法线贴图中,每个像素的颜色值代表法线的方向,从而影响光照效果,使得海浪看起来更加逼真。
1.2 海浪法线贴图的作用
海浪法线贴图能够模拟出海洋表面的细微波动,如波浪、泡沫等,使海洋景观更加生动和真实。
二、海浪法线贴图的制作方法
2.1 收集参考素材
在制作海浪法线贴图之前,收集高质量的海洋图片和视频是至关重要的。这些素材将作为制作过程中的参考,帮助开发者捕捉到海浪的真实特征。
2.2 创建基础海浪模型
使用3D建模软件(如Blender、Maya等)创建一个基础的海浪模型。这个模型将作为后续贴图的基础。
2.3 分割模型
将海浪模型分割成多个部分,以便在贴图过程中更好地控制每个部分的细节。
2.4 创建法线贴图
使用法线贴图生成器(如Substance Designer、Nuke等)创建法线贴图。在这个过程中,需要调整法线贴图的参数,如波高、波长、泡沫密度等,以模拟真实海浪的特征。
2.5 应用法线贴图
将生成的法线贴图应用到海浪模型上。在应用过程中,需要调整贴图的缩放比例和偏移量,以确保贴图与模型完美匹配。
2.6 渲染和优化
渲染海浪模型,并对渲染结果进行优化。这包括调整光照、阴影、水面反射等参数,以提升整体视觉效果。
三、实际应用中的技巧
3.1 动态海浪效果
为了实现动态海浪效果,可以使用粒子系统或流体模拟技术。这些技术能够模拟海浪的动态变化,使海洋景观更加生动。
3.2 环境交互
在游戏或电影中,海浪效果应与周围环境相互作用。例如,海浪可以影响船只的航行、破坏海岸线等。
3.3 光照和阴影
合理的光照和阴影效果能够进一步提升海浪的真实感。例如,阳光照射在波浪上会产生反射和折射效果,而阴影则能够突出波浪的轮廓。
四、总结
海浪法线贴图是一种强大的技术,能够为游戏和电影中的海洋景观带来逼真的效果。通过本文的介绍,读者可以了解到海浪法线贴图的工作原理、制作方法以及实际应用中的技巧。掌握这些知识,将为创作者带来更加丰富的创作空间。
